Realme 7i was spotted on Geekbench ahead of its official launch on September 17. The listing on Geekbench confirms earlier leaks that the Realme 7i will be powered by the Snapdragon 662 processor with 8GB RAM. The Realme 7i is set to be launched in Malaysia on September 17.
As per the listing on Geekbench, the Realme 7i is powered by Qualcomm Snapdragon 662 processor and is paired with 8GB RAM, running on Android 10. The base core frequency is listed as 1.80GHz with the phone receiving 1516 score in single-core tests and 5420 score in multi-core tests.

Some images and promotional posters were posted online, revealing the design of the upcoming budget smartphone. The Realme 7i is seen to come with a rectangular camera module on the back with the brand’s logo at the bottom and a fingerprint sensor in the middle.
The Realme 7i also has a punch-hole cutout for the selfie camera upfront with noticeable bezel on the bottom. Let’s take a look at the leaked specifications of the Realme 7i.
Realme 7i leaked specifications
Realme 7i could feature a 6.5-inch HD+ (1600 x 720 pixels) resolution display with a 90Hz high refresh rate. The screen has a punch-hole cutout for the 16MP selfie camera housed in the top-left corner.

According to the images leaked, the Realme 7i could be powered by the Qualcomm Snapdragon 662 processor and will be paired with at least 8GB RAM and 128GB storage. However, there could be multiple variants at the time of launch. The fingerprint sensor is situated on the rear panel.
It comes with a quad-camera setup on the back that consists of a primary 64MP camera, an 8MP ultra-wide-angle camera, 2MP macro lens and a 2MP depth sensor.
